Specialized Treatment Focus: Cedar Court’s Head Spa Experiences
Cedar Court Hotel‘s head spa packages, the Blissful Experience and Flowerfall Experience, are centered around an extensive 105-minute treatment. This lengthy session allows for a comprehensive scalp massage, deep cleansing, exfoliation, and aromatherapy, promoting improved scalp health and profound relaxation. Compared to the more common 50-minute treatments offered at other hotels, the extra 55 minutes provide ample time to address tension points and deliver a truly immersive wellness ritual.
The Blissful Experience emphasizes holistic relaxation, while the Flowerfall Experience incorporates seasonal floral elements for a rejuvenating twist. Both are ideal for guests who prioritize hair and scalp care or simply desire an extended spa journey.

What’s Included in Harrogate Spa Weekend Packages?

Treatment Types and Durations: ESPA, Head Spa, and Hydrotherapy
- ESPA brand treatments: Typically 50 minutes, offered at DoubleTree by Hilton Majestic. These include massages (e.g., Swedish, deep tissue), facials, and body wraps using high-end ESPA products. The treatments focus on relaxation, skin rejuvenation, and overall well-being. ESPA treatments often begin with a personalized consultation to tailor the experience.
- Extended head spa treatments: At Cedar Court Hotel, the Blissful and Flowerfall experiences last 105 minutes. They encompass scalp massage, thorough cleansing, exfoliation, and aromatherapy, targeting scalp health, stress relief, and hair vitality. Head spa sessions typically incorporate hot towel wraps and premium oils.
- Hydrotherapy sessions: Featured at Rudding Park‘s Roof Top Spa, these water-based therapies include jet pools, contrast showers, thermal beds, and possibly an outdoor infinity pool. Hydrotherapy improves circulation, eases muscle tension, and aids recovery, making it popular among athletes and those with physical ailments. As a race car driver, I personally value hydrotherapy for its recovery benefits.
Each category offers distinct benefits; your choice depends on whether you prioritize classic relaxation (ESPA), targeted scalp care (head spa), or therapeutic water healing (hydrotherapy).

Accommodation and Extras: Overnight Stays, Early Check-In, Late Check-Out
All spa weekend packages include overnight accommodation, typically in a standard double or twin room, with options to upgrade at an additional cost. The Crown Hotel stands out by offering early check-in (often from 11am) and late check-out (until 2pm) as part of select packages. These extended hours effectively add several hours to your weekend, allowing you to enjoy the spa facilities before you’ve even checked in or after you’ve checked out.
Such flexibility is particularly valuable for those traveling from afar or wishing to maximize relaxation time without rushing. Additional extras may include complimentary breakfast, access to fitness centers, welcome drinks, or even turndown service.
When comparing packages, factor in the monetary value of these perks; early check-in and late check-out alone can be worth £30-£50 per person if purchased separately. They transform a standard overnight stay into a true two-night experience.

Booking Channels: Direct vs. Third-Party Platforms
You can book spa weekend packages directly through the hotel’s official website or via specialist third-party platforms like Spabreaks.com and SpaSeekers.com. Direct booking often yields benefits such as loyalty points, the ability to request specific room preferences or treatment times, and sometimes exclusive upgrades. Hotels may also offer a best-rate guarantee or added perks like a welcome drink for direct bookings.
Third-party platforms, on the other hand, aggregate multiple hotel deals, making it easy to compare prices and inclusions across different properties. They sometimes negotiate discounted rates or package bundles not available directly. For the best value, check both channels: start with the hotel’s site to see the standard package, then search on third-party sites for any promotions.
Regardless of where you book, early reservation is crucial, especially for weekend slots and popular treatments like the 105-minute head spa at Cedar Court, which tends to fill up weeks in advance. Cancellation policies vary, so read the terms carefully before committing.
